在日常使用电脑的过程中,许多用户可能会遇到“诊断策略服务(Diagnostic Policy Service)”被禁用的情况。这种情况通常会导致系统无法正常运行某些诊断功能,从而影响用户体验。那么,当遇到“诊断策略服务已被禁用”的问题时,我们应该如何解决呢?以下是一些实用的解决方法和建议。
什么是诊断策略服务?
诊断策略服务是Windows操作系统中的一个核心服务,主要负责收集和处理硬件及软件故障信息。它能够帮助系统及时发现潜在的问题,并通过自动更新或修复机制来解决问题。因此,该服务的正常运行对于系统的稳定性和安全性至关重要。
诊断策略服务被禁用的原因
1. 手动操作失误:部分用户可能出于安全考虑或其他原因,误将该服务设置为禁用状态。
2. 第三方软件冲突:某些安全软件或优化工具可能会干扰系统服务的正常运行。
3. 系统文件损坏:由于病毒攻击或系统错误,可能导致服务相关文件丢失或损坏。
4. 权限不足:普通用户可能没有足够的权限对服务进行启停操作。
解决方案
方法一:通过服务管理器重新启用服务
1. 按下键盘上的`Win + R`组合键,打开“运行”窗口。
2. 输入`services.msc`并按回车键,进入服务管理界面。
3. 在列表中找到“诊断策略服务”(Diagnostic Policy Service),右键点击选择“属性”。
4. 在弹出的窗口中,将启动类型设置为“自动”,然后点击“启动”按钮以激活服务。
5. 最后点击“确定”保存更改。
方法二:检查组策略设置
1. 按下`Win + R`组合键,输入`gpedit.msc`并回车,打开本地组策略编辑器。
2. 导航至“计算机配置 -> 管理模板 -> 系统 -> 诊断策略”。
3. 查看是否有与诊断策略相关的限制项,如果有,则将其恢复为默认值。
4. 应用更改并重启计算机。
方法三:使用命令行工具修复
1. 打开命令提示符(以管理员身份运行)。
2. 输入以下命令并按回车:
```
sc config DiagTrack start= auto
```
这条命令的作用是将诊断跟踪服务设置为自动启动。
3. 接着输入以下命令启动服务:
```
net start DiagTrack
```
方法四:检查系统日志
如果上述方法无效,可以尝试查看系统日志以获取更多线索:
1. 按下`Win + R`组合键,输入`eventvwr.msc`并回车,打开事件查看器。
2. 在左侧菜单中选择“Windows 日志 -> 应用程序和服务日志 -> Microsoft -> Windows -> Diagnostics-Performance”。
3. 查找最近的时间戳,查看是否存在与诊断策略服务相关的错误信息。
预防措施
为了避免类似问题再次发生,建议采取以下措施:
1. 定期更新操作系统和驱动程序,确保系统始终处于最新状态。
2. 安装正规渠道下载的安全软件,避免不必要的干扰。
3. 不要随意修改系统服务的默认设置,尤其是涉及关键功能的服务。
总结
当遇到“诊断策略服务已被禁用”的情况时,用户不必过于担心,按照上述步骤逐一排查即可解决问题。同时,养成良好的使用习惯有助于减少此类问题的发生概率。希望本文能为大家提供有效的帮助!